Property Listings — Robeline, LA

As of Oct '25, Realtor.com reports that the median days on market for a home in Robeline, LA is 209. This is a increase of 144.0% from last year, suggesting that homes are sitting on the market longer than last year. The percentage of listed homes with a reduced price is 0.0%, representing a small inventory and little supply pressure on home prices.

Demographics — Robeline, LA

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Robeline, LA has a population of 2,910, which has increased by 25.3% over the past 5 years. Robeline, LA is a moderately popular place for families, as children make up 21.7% of the population. The area has a poorly educated workforce, with 14.5% of adult residents holding a bachelor’s degree or higher. There are some residents working remotely, with 10.1% reporting working from home.

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Robeline, LA is a predominantly white area, with 85.6% of the population identifying as white. The white population has grown by 0.1% in the last 5 years. The second most common race or ethnicity in Robeline, LA is hispanic, making up 8.0% of the population. Foreign-born residents account for 0.3% of the population in Robeline, LA, and this percentage has decreased by 75.0% as of the ACS Survey 5 years prior, suggesting fewer immigrants are calling the area home.
